Explore the application of constrained simulations in understanding the galaxy-halo connection in this 32-minute conference talk by Yen-ting Lin from the International Centre for Theoretical Sciences. Delve into the cutting-edge research presented as part of the "Largest Cosmological Surveys and Big Data Science" program, which aims to advance our understanding of precision cosmology and large-scale structures in the Universe. Gain insights into how constrained simulations contribute to unraveling the complex relationship between galaxies and their dark matter halos, and learn about the latest developments in this field of cosmological research.
